#compile options for gnuchess
# -DAG[0-4]  selects a set of values for SpaceBonus tables
# -DQUIETBACKGROUND don't print post information in background ( easy OFF)
# -DNOMEMSET if your machine does not support memset
# -DNOMATERIAL don't call it a draw when no pawns and both sides < rook
# -DNODYNALPHA don't dynamically adjust alpha
# -DHISTORY use history killer hueristic 
# -DKILLT use killt killer hueristic 
# -DHASGETTIMEOFDAY use gettimeofday for more accurate timing
# -DCLIENT create client version for use with ICS
# -DNOSCORESPACE don't use Scorespace heuristic
# -DOLDXBOARD don't generate underpromote moves
# -DGNU3 don't generate underpromote moves
# -DLONG64 if you have 64bit longs
# -DSYSV   if you are using SYSV
# -DCACHE  Cache static evaluations 
# -DE4OPENING always open e4 if white and respond to e4 with e5 if black
# -DQUIETBOOKGEN Don't print errors while loading a book or generating a binbook
# -DSEMIQUIETBOOKGEN Print less verbose errors while reading book or generating binbook
# -DGDBM use gdbm based book
# -DGDX  use random file based book
# -DNULLMOVE include null move heuristic
# some debug options
# -DDEBUG8 dump board,movelist,input move to /tmp/DEBUG if illegal move
# -DDEBUG9 dump move list from test command
# -DDEBUG10 dump board and move after search before !easy begins
# -DDEBUG11 dump board when the move is output
# -DDEBUG12 dump boards between moves
# -DDEBUG13 dump search control information for each move to /tmp/DEBUG
# -DDEBUG40 include extra values of variables for debugging  in game list
# -DDEBUG41 dump post output to /tmp/DEBUG
# the rest of the debug options are tied to the debuglevel command
# -DDEBUG -DDEBUG4 set up code for debuglevel command
#          debuglevel
#               1 always force evaluation in evaluate
#               4 print move list after search
#               8 print move list after book before search
#              16 print move list after each ply of search
#              32 print adds to transposition table
#              64 print returns from transposition table lookups
#	      256 print search tree as it is generated
#	      512 debug trace
#	     1024 interactive tree print
#			debug? p#  where # is no. of plys to print from top of tree (default all plys)
#			       XXXX moves specifying branch of tree to print (default all branches)
#			       return terminates input
#	     2048 non-interactive trace print
